The Ageless Allure of Hats: A Short Timeline

Hats have been used for a long time as both functional and fashionable accessories, mirroring societal norms and personal style throughout history. From ancient civilizations to modern times, hats have played a vital role in signaling status, profession, and identity. For instance, in ancient Egypt, pharaohs donned complex headdresses to demonstrate their divine rule. The Middle Ages witnessed the popularity of pointed hats, often denoting social position or occupation. In the 18th century, fancy wigs and tricorn hats became symbols of European aristocracy. The 19th and early 20th centuries saw a variety of styles, such as the bowler and fedora, highlighting key shifts in fashion read the information and gender roles. As society progressed, the hat's function shifted—from protecting against weather to showcasing individuality. Nowadays, hats continue to fascinate, combining tradition with contemporary fashions while boosting personal expression in wardrobes.

What Hat Works Best Your Facial Type?

What is the way to guarantee the perfect hat complements their face shape? Selecting the right hat involves understanding the measurements and angles of one’s face. For individuals with a round face, styles like wide-brimmed hats or angular designs can add definition. Those with an oval face shape have more flexibility; nearly any style can enhance their features. For square faces, softer, rounded hats can help balance sharp angles, and heart-shaped faces often look nice in hats with wider brims or styles that draw attention downward. For long faces, hats that add width, including floppies or fedoras, can be complementary. In the end, selecting a hat that balances facial features and offers comfort and style is key. Following these guidelines, one can confidently choose a hat that brings out their natural beauty.

Hat Upkeep: Preservation and Storage

Safeguarding the longevity of a hat entails diligent care and proper storage methods. Regular cleaning is indispensable; for textile hats, gentle brushing can expel particles and dust, while felt hats may benefit from specialized cleaning solutions. Protect hats from direct sun for prolonged periods, as this can cause fading and deterioration.

When it comes to storing, hats should be kept in a cool, dry place. Using a storage box or a designated shelf keeps them from becoming misshapen. For hats with wide brims, it is advisable to store them inverted to maintain their shape. Prevent stacking hats, as this can cause crease marks or damage. Additionally, caring for the brim and crown by handling them carefully will extend their lifespan. By adhering to these maintenance and storage practices, hat enthusiasts can ensure their preferred hats remain in great shape for years to come.

How Do I Determine My Head for a Ideal Fit?

Calculate for a optimal hat fit by using a soft tape measure around the widest area of the head, usually right above the ears and eyebrows, guaranteeing a snug but comfortable fit.

Are There Any Headwear Etiquette Rules to Follow?

Hat etiquette often demands removing hats indoors, particularly in restaurants and homes, abstaining from wearing them during the national anthem, and selecting appropriate designs for formal events. Grasping these rules guarantees respectful and fashionable hat-wearing.
